CTLA-4 is not required for induction of CD8(+) T cell anergy in vivo.
Recent studies of T cell anergy induction have produced conflicting conclusions as to the role of the negative regulatory receptor, CTLA-4. Several in vivo models of tolerance have implicated the interaction of CTLA-4 and its ligands, B7.1 and B7.2, as an essential step in induction of anergy, while results from a number of other systems have indicated that signals from the TCR/CD3 complex alon...

Caspase-3 Is Transiently Activated without Cell Death during Early Antigen Driven Expansion of CD8+ T Cells In Vivo
BACKGROUND CD8(+) T cell responses develop rapidly during infection and are swiftly reduced during contraction, wherein >90% of primed CD8(+) T cells are eliminated. The role of apoptotic mechanisms in controlling this rapid proliferation and contraction of CD8(+) T cells remains unclear. Surprisingly, evidence has shown non-apoptotic activation of caspase-3 to occur during in vitro T-cell prol...
